Old Diner in Dallas West End with value Meals

By Texas_Travel_1 |

Legend says that Bonnie and Clyde met here. Clyde walked out without paying his tab. Bonnie went out after him and never returned. (Other historians say they met what was then west Dallas.) The Record Grill provides value breakfast and lunches in the West End of downtown Dallas. (Look for blue and white building). My guest ordered the burger and fry special. I ordered the daily specials. Meal was served promptly. The sides of green beans provided great flavor and were not over/under cooked. Mash potatoes were served with a bit too much pepper. Meat was moist, flavorful, and grilled just right. The fans provide some cooling since the Record Grill is not air conditioned. Also bring cash.

Unexpected treat in a parking lot

By LeRoy_far |

We accidentally stumbled on the Record grill while walking around downtown Dallas. We went in out of a since of adventure and guessed it would be good based on the ages old grease stain above the exhaust fan on the roof. We guessed right, the food was good and prices cheap. Service was good as well. It is so tiny you have to go outside to change your mind. Tables and chairs are old and minimalistic but clean and in good condition. We later learned it has a long history and may have been the place where Bonnie and Clyde met. Give it a try, keep your expectations reasonable.
